Could some one Descibe the abiotic and biotic factors that affect the ecosystem?

Abiotic factors of a ecosystem are physical non living ones such as the weather, soil, a river, anything that's a not living.Biotic factors include biological influences on organisms such as the types of plants growing, and the species of animals in the ecosystem, and any factor that's living.Together abiotic and biotic factors determine the survival and growth of and organism.


What are three examples of nonliving factors supplied to organisms by their physical environment?

Nonliving factors that are found in an organism's physical environment are also known as abiotic factors. Abiotic factors can be physical or chemical. Examples include light, water, air, soil, and temperature. These various factors can affect different organisms in different ways.

What are the parts of the environment?

There are two factors in an environment. Biotic factors and abiotic factors. Biotic factors are living organisms that affect other organisms. Abiotic factors are non-living factors such as temperature, sunlight, humidity, soil, etc.
